无论你是初学者还是经验丰富的管理员,掌握高效、可靠地查找和下载Linux镜像包的技巧都是至关重要的
本文将详细介绍在Linux系统中如何寻找镜像包的多种方法,并提供一系列实用的策略和工具,帮助你快速准确地找到所需资源
一、理解Linux镜像包的基本概念 首先,我们需要明确什么是Linux镜像包
在Linux生态系统中,镜像包通常指的是包含操作系统、应用程序、库文件等内容的压缩文件,这些文件通常以`.iso`、`.deb`(Debian及其衍生版如Ubuntu)、`.rpm`(Red Hat及其衍生版如CentOS)、`.tar.gz`等格式存在
镜像包可以用于安装操作系统、更新软件包、添加新功能或修复系统问题
二、官方发行版仓库 1. 使用包管理器 Linux发行版通常配备有强大的包管理器,如`apt`(Debian/Ubuntu)、`yum`或`dnf`(Red Hat/CentOS)、`zypper`(openSUSE)等
这些工具能够自动处理依赖关系,并提供从官方仓库安装软件包的便捷方式
Debian/Ubuntu系列: bash sudo apt update sudo apt search <软件包名> sudo apt install <软件包名> `apt search`命令可以帮助你查找软件包,而`aptinstall`则用于安装
Red Hat/CentOS系列: bash sudo yum update sudo yum search <软件包名> sudo yum install <软件包名> 或对于较新的版本使用`dnf`: bash sudo dnf update sudo dnf search <软件包名> sudo dnf install <软件包名> 2. 官方镜像站点 每个Linux发行版都有自己的官方镜像站点,这些站点提供了完整的ISO镜像、软件包仓库等
访问这些站点可以直接下载所需的镜像包
例如: - Ubuntu:【Ubuntu官方镜像】(https://ubuntu.com/download/desktop) - Debian:【Debian官方镜像】(https://www.debian.org/distrib/) - CentOS:【CentOS官方镜像】(https://mirror.centos.org/) - Fedora:【Fedora官方镜像】(https://getfedora.org/en/workstation/download/) 三、第三方软件仓库和源 除了官方仓库,还有许多第三方软件仓库和源提供了额外的软件包,这些包可能不在官方仓库中
使用这些源可以获取更多软件选择,但需要注意安全性和稳定性
- Flatpak和Snap:这两种应用打包格式允许在不修改系统的情况下安装和运行应用程序,它们有自己的应用商店
bash 安装Flatpak sudo apt install flatpak fl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o flatpak install flathub <应用名> 安装Snap sudo apt install snapd sudo snap install <应用名> - PPA(Personal Package Archives):对于Ubuntu用户,PPA提供了由社区维护的软件包
bash
sudo add-apt-repository ppa:<用户名>/ 通过参与社区讨论,你可以获得来自其他用户的第一手经验和建议
- 论坛:如【Ubuntu Forums】(https://ubuntuforums.org/)、【Red HatForum】(https://community.redhat.com/community/forums/redhat)等
- 问答网站:如【Stack Overflow】(https://stackoverflow.com/)、【Ask Ubuntu】(https://askubuntu.com/)等
- 邮件列表和IRC频道:许多Linux项目都有活跃的邮件列表和IRC频道,这些渠道是获取即时帮助的好地方
五、镜像搜索引擎和目录
互联网上有许多镜像搜索引擎和目录,它们聚合了来自不同来源的Linux镜像包信息,方便用户搜索和下载
- SourceForge:【SourceForge】(https://sourceforge.net/)是一个开源软件项目的托管平台,提供了大量Linux软件的下载链接
- Freshmeat:【Freshmeat】(https://freshmeat.net/)是一个软件发布目录,包含了广泛的开源软件信息
- Distrowatch:【Distrowatch】(https://distrowatch.com/)不仅提供了对各种Linux发行版的详细介绍和评测,还提供了下载链接
六、安全注意事项
在下载和安装镜像包时,务必注意以下几点以确保系统安全:
- 验证签名:确保下载的镜像包经过官方签名验证,避免使用未经授权的源
- 检查哈希值:使用sha256sum等工具检查下载文件的哈希值,与官方提供的哈希值进行比对
- 保持警惕:对于来自未知或不可信来源的镜像包,要保持高度警惕,避免潜在的恶意软件
七、总结
寻找Linux镜像包的过程并不复杂,关键在于选择合适的工具和渠道 官方发行版仓库是最可靠的选择,而第三方软件仓库和源则提供了更多的灵活性 社区和论坛是获取帮助和信息的宝贵资源,而镜像搜索引擎和目录则让搜索过程更加高效 最重要的是,无论使用哪种方式,都要时刻注意安全性,确保系统和数据的安全
通过本文的介绍,相信你已经掌握了在Linux系统中寻找镜像包的基本方法和高效策略 无论是在学习、工作还是日常使用中,这些技巧都将帮助你更加高效地管理Linux系统,享受Linux带来的强大功能和无限可能